The diamond rings found inside Diamond Candles may be either costume jewelry, or made from 14k gold and diamonds. If the ring is costume jewelry, it is worth about $10, if it is a gold and diamond ring, it could be worth hundreds or even thousands of dollars.

If you are seeing AM-G on the inside of a gold diamond ring, it is probably the makers signature. A lot of designer companies will engrave the makers signature on the inside of the jewelry to help identify its worth.

The number inside a diamond ring refers to the carat weight of the diamonds found in the ring. A .50 stamped inside a Diamond Solitaire ring means that it has a 1/2 Carat diamond while a .97 means that it is just below 100 points or One Full Carat.
